Romek123 42 Posted March 24, 2022 Posted March 24, 2022 How i can lock Custom Made Collections so they don't get deleted? As title says. I have tons of collections and they are all perfectly fine created abd i love it. But i want to add some additional Colelctions for Movieverses like Wizarding World, Marvel etc. I created them all and it worked great for a while, but now they are all gone (only the self created ones) I guess that did happen after i manually clicked the "scan library" button How i can avoid this in future?
GrimReaper 4740 Posted March 24, 2022 Posted March 24, 2022 2 minutes ago, Romek123 said: How i can avoid this in future? Save NFOs with media.
Romek123 42 Posted March 24, 2022 Author Posted March 24, 2022 i use NFOs but for example all star trek movies have collections already - and this is saved in NFO now i wanna add an additional collection in emby "Star Trek - Universe" with all star trek movies and shows. Without removing old collections this works fine and looks good. until i scan media manually again. than they get deleted and this star trek movies have only the official collections
GrimReaper 4740 Posted March 24, 2022 Posted March 24, 2022 2 minutes ago, Romek123 said: i use NFOs Are those NFOs created by Emby or 3-rd party app? Are they maybe locked? As an item can have multiple <set> nodes, as in as many Collections it belongs to.
Romek123 42 Posted March 24, 2022 Author Posted March 24, 2022 (edited) NFOs are created with TinyMediaManager of course they are locked - i don't want to change my manually maintained data with some random scrape processes. but looks like i found the solution by myself. in configuration is metadata manager. i did go to the self created collection and there i have at the end the option to lock this collection from changes. just manually scanned library and still have this collection so i guess its working now Edited March 24, 2022 by Romek123
Romek123 42 Posted March 25, 2022 Author Posted March 25, 2022 ok - does not work. all custom made collections are gone again. so is it not possible to have additional custom collections when use NFO's?
Happy2Play 9781 Posted March 25, 2022 Posted March 25, 2022 23 hours ago, Romek123 said: in configuration is metadata manager. i did go to the self created collection and there i have at the end the option to lock this collection from changes. I am guessing you are locking the Collection not the items and that will do anything really. Collections are all about individual movie item metadata now. For a custom collection to disappear something would have to remove the <set> node from items. simple example member of provider collection and custom collection per movie member nfo <set tmdbcolid="125574"> <name>The Amazing Spider-Man Collection</name> </set> <set> <name>1 Test Collection TEST</name> </set>
Romek123 42 Posted March 25, 2022 Author Posted March 25, 2022 i tested this with one single movie in a collection - star trek 1 - i locked everything in metadata that was possible to lock and i even deleted the tmdb id but after scanning my library the custom one was gone again - it ignores all the lock stuff and reads everyhting from NFO again so you mean i should delete the collection in my NFO?
Happy2Play 9781 Posted March 25, 2022 Posted March 25, 2022 (edited) I cannot make anything disappear from a collection with a single or full library scan. But @Lukeshould I be able to remove an item from a collection when the item metadata is locked? Basically, we can say <set> cannot be locked right now. But at the same time Locked items will/would prevent new Collections from every being made. So I see the argument either way. Edited March 25, 2022 by Happy2Play added info
Luke 42079 Posted March 25, 2022 Posted March 25, 2022 2 hours ago, Happy2Play said: I cannot make anything disappear from a collection with a single or full library scan. But @Lukeshould I be able to remove an item from a collection when the item metadata is locked? Basically, we can say <set> cannot be locked right now. But at the same time Locked items will/would prevent new Collections from every being made. So I see the argument either way. I guess it might come back later at some point if the server can't update the nfo file. If there's no nfo then it should be fine.
Romek123 42 Posted March 25, 2022 Author Posted March 25, 2022 I just tested this. deleted the movie-set with TinyMedia Manager for Star Trek 1 movie than i updated library in emby and after some time this movie had no movie-set as it should than i added this movie in emby to the star trek collection and updated library again it removed collection again checked the nfo and there is only one line for set: <set/> so this did not help at all i made screenshot from my settings for this library (attachements)
Romek123 42 Posted March 25, 2022 Author Posted March 25, 2022 go to configuration on server there i go to library click on the ... for my movie library and here "Bilbiothek scannen" (rescan library i guess)
Luke 42079 Posted March 26, 2022 Posted March 26, 2022 Maybe tiny media manager removed it from the nfo ?
Romek123 42 Posted March 26, 2022 Author Posted March 26, 2022 (edited) Looks like its working now. i unmarked the: [ ] Nfo - Dateiformat für die Speicherung der Metadaten wählen. i rescanned library now 3x and custom collections are not gone well, i will montitor this for 1-2 days but it looks good for now ... Edited March 26, 2022 by Romek123
Luke 42079 Posted March 26, 2022 Posted March 26, 2022 If and when tmm updates then nfo and removes them you'll see them getting removed from emby as well.
Happy2Play 9781 Posted March 26, 2022 Posted March 26, 2022 Testing in TMM it does not handle multiple sets unless I do not have it configured so any save in TMM will remove additional sets added by Emby in my limited testing. @GrimReaperdoes that sound correct?
Romek123 42 Posted March 26, 2022 Author Posted March 26, 2022 is correct - tmm saves only 1 Set. not possible to choose more than one
GrimReaper 4740 Posted March 26, 2022 Posted March 26, 2022 (edited) 1 hour ago, Happy2Play said: Testing in TMM it does not handle multiple sets unless I do not have it configured so any save in TMM will remove additional sets added by Emby in my limited testing. @GrimReaperdoes that sound correct? Correct, if Emby is allowed to re-write NFO, subsequent update from TMM will remove extra <set> nodes and leave only one (auto-TMDB), as it doesn't handle custom/multiple collections/movie sets. Edit: https://gitlab.com/tinyMediaManager/tinyMediaManager/-/issues/1617 Edited March 26, 2022 by GrimReaper Link
Romek123 42 Posted March 26, 2022 Author Posted March 26, 2022 (edited) ok it works now made yesterday different test colelctions and they did not get removed after several library rescans - i only unmarked this in movie library config: ------------------------------------------ Metadatenformat: Nfo [ ] Dateiformat für die Speicherung der Metadaten wählen ------------------------------------------ And for the TMM question: - no, emby does not save additional collections to NFO's too. I did not rescan this movies with TMM so TMM changed nothing and still emby removed them with a library rescan. - now i have unmarked saving to NFO's and it looks like EMBY saves this data somewhere on my NAS in his own folders - and it works Edited March 26, 2022 by Romek123
pünktchen 1409 Posted March 26, 2022 Posted March 26, 2022 2 hours ago, Romek123 said: no, emby does not save additional collections to NFO's too. It's because of this: On 3/24/2022 at 8:05 PM, Romek123 said: NFOs are created with TinyMediaManager of course they are locked
Luke 42079 Posted March 26, 2022 Posted March 26, 2022 6 hours ago, Romek123 said: And for the TMM question: - no, emby does not save additional collections to NFO's too. I did not rescan this movies with TMM so TMM changed nothing and still emby removed them with a library rescan. Yes it does, but it looks like TMM removes them later.
Happy2Play 9781 Posted March 26, 2022 Posted March 26, 2022 6 hours ago, Romek123 said: ok it works now made yesterday different test colelctions and they did not get removed after several library rescans - i only unmarked this in movie library config: ------------------------------------------ Metadatenformat: Nfo [ ] Choose a file format to store metadata ------------------------------------------ And for the TMM question: - no, emby does not save additional collections to NFO's too. I did not rescan this movies with TMM so TMM changed nothing and still emby removed them with a library rescan. - now i have unmarked saving to NFO's and it looks like EMBY saves this data somewhere on my NAS in his own folders - and it works No it is only saved in the database so if anything happens to that database the info is lost. But do not agree with the rest.
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now